gizzard
/ˈgɪzəd/noun
1- a muscular, thick-walled part of a bird's stomach for grinding food, typically with grit砂囊(鸟类动物胃中的一个部分), 肫, 胗。
1.1
- a muscular stomach of some fish, insects, molluscs, and other invertebrates(某些鱼、昆虫、软体动物及其他无脊椎动物的)胃, 肫, 胗。
1.2
- informal a person's stomach or throat〈非正式〉(人的)胃(或喉咙):
the fans wanted to see him rip the gizzards out of bad guys.
影迷们想看到他把坏蛋剖腹挖心。
词源
late Middle English giser: from Old French, based on Latin gigeria 'cooked entrails of fowl'. The final -d was added in the 16th cent.
